Off your own property, a dog in unincorporated Kootenai County must be on a leash no longer than five feet and controlled by a capable person. Hunting and law-enforcement dogs under voice control are exempt.
Kootenai County Code 5.1.106 ("Dogs At Large") bars any owner from letting a dog remain on a street, alley, public place, or another person's premises unless it is leashed on a lead no more than five feet long, of sufficient strength, held by someone able to control it. Idaho Code 25-2805 separately makes it an infraction to willfully or negligently permit a dog to run at large without a competent attendant near towns, farms, ranches, dwellings, or another's cultivated land. Cities like Coeur d'Alene and Post Falls set their own leash rules inside city limits.
Running at large is impoundable under 5.1.114; state infraction under Idaho Code 25-2805. Owners pay impound and boarding fees to reclaim the dog.
